Capsaicin is the compound responsible for cayenne's heat, and it's studied for a short-lived thermogenic response — a brief, modest rise in how many calories the body burns at rest.

Trials also link it to a mild reduction in appetite at the next meal, though the effect is described as a nudge rather than anything dramatic.
